## Who to Contact: Flagwright Rollouts

Flagwright is owned by the Delivery Enablement group. For rollout plan reviews, ask in the weekly triage; for stuck percentage ramps or kill-switch issues, page the rotation. New team members should read the rollout playbook before filing anything. For access requests and general questions, the team can be reached at the address below.

alerts address for kajog-tadup: druox@plorvanet.internal

Ticket PLG-4471: Expired credentials — SocketThrift compression gateway. Plugin authors: tokens issued before the permessage-deflate rollout expired Tuesday. Symptom: handshake succeeds, then 4403 close on first compressed frame. Note the tradeoff: compression on saves ~40% bandwidth but adds CPU on small frames; leave it off for chatty plugins. Re-auth against the Framelock staging broker to verify your setup. Use the replacement key below.

gateway credential: kto3_qfe

Handover note — PinPoint autocomplete widget

Welcome aboard. I'm handing PinPoint over to Ilsa's team this sprint. The widget itself is stable; most incidents come from the geocoding upstream throttling us during evening peaks, so watch the retry dashboard first. Releases go out Tuesdays, feature flags are managed in Flagwright, and the staging dataset refreshes nightly. Everything you need to run it locally is in the repo, except the runtime settings, which are as follows.

service settings:
[casax]
port = 6379
team = rusir
host = casax.zemvarhq.corp
region = outer-4
access_code = ac_9808ce
timeout_ms = 1500

**Vendor note: Quillbroker upgrade**

Heads up for the sync — Fernhollow Systems is pushing us to move Quillbroker from 4.x to 6.x by end of quarter, since 4.x support lapses soon. The jump skips a major version, so we'll need a staging soak of at least two weeks. Their sales rep keeps pinging me about contract renewal; I'd rather settle the upgrade plan first. Questions for the vendor should go to their support desk below.

escalation mailbox, fafof-bahip: tamael@ordincorp.test